Ingredients and spices that need to be Make ready to make Dal Palak:

  1. For boiling Palak
  2. 500 grams Palak
  3. 500 ml Water
  4. as per taste Salt
  5. as required Lemon juice
  6. cubes Ice
  7. 1 glass Ice cold water
  8. For Boiling Dal
  9. 1 cup Toor Dal
  10. 1/4 cup Chana dal
  11. 1/2 cup Moong dal
  12. 3 tbsp Masoor dal
  13. as required Water
  14. as per taste Salt
  15. as required Turmeric powder
  16. as required Garam masala
  17. as required Lemon juice
  18. For making Dal Palak
  19. 2 tbsp Olive oil
  20. 1 cup Finely chopped Onions
  21. 1 cup Finely chopped Tomatoes
  22. 2 tbsp Minced Ginger garlic
  23. as per taste Salt
  24. 2 tbsp Red Chilli powder
  25. 1 tsp Green chilli paste
  26. 1 tsp Garam masala
  27. as required Boiled palak
  28. as required Boiled Dal
  29. as per required Water (to adjust consistency)
  30. as required Lemon juice
  31. 1 tbsp Desi Ghee
  32. For tadka
  33. 1 tbsp Desi Ghee
  34. 1 tsp Jeera seeds (Cumin seeds)
  35. 1/2 tsp Red Chilli powder
  36. as per taste Salt
  37. 1 whole dried red chilled (break into two pieces)

Steps to make Dal Palak

  1. First for boiling Palak, we have to boil the water really well and add the Palak in it. Turn off the flame immediately and let it blanch for 2 minutes.
  2. Now before Removing the Palak from hot water, add in some salt and lemon juice. It will help the Palak to retain its beautiful green colour.
  3. Now immediately add the boiled palak in Ice cold water with some extra ice, this will also help to retain the colour.
  4. Now to boil the Dal, take all the Dal mentioned above and wash it thoroughly. Once washed, let it soak for 15 minutes. Now, add the dal in the pressure cooker and add salt and boil for 4 whistle on low flame. I have added a few leaves of Palak in the dal as well to get the flavour.
  5. Now for making Dal Palak, add Oil, Ginger garlic, Onions and saute it till golden brown.
  6. Then add Red Chilli powder, Turmeric powder, Coriander powder and salt and mix it together. Add Tomatoes.
  7. Add the Tomatoes and mix it well. Cook it till mushy. Once it's done, add boiled palak.
  8. Add boiled Palak and mix it well. And cook it until well combined with the spices. And salt if needed more.
  9. Add in some Garam masala and mix it well. Cook it until the Palak slightly changes its Colour.
  10. Once the oil is released, add in the cooked dal.
  11. Mix the dal with the Palak until well combined. Cook it for a few more minutes. Heat the oil separately.
  12. Once the oil is nicely heated, add some cumin seeds and a dries chilli broken in two pieces and once it sputters nicely, add the tempering in the Dal we prepared.
  13. Mix the tempering well with the Dal and cook it for 2 minutes more.
